Apple iPhone 7: A Refinement of Perfection
Apple’s iPhone 7 was a testament to the company’s commitment to refining its products. With a 4.7-inch Retina HD display, a dual-core A10 Fusion chip, and up to 256GB of storage, the iPhone 7 was an incremental yet significant update over the iPhone 6S. The device also introduced water and dust resistance, a feature that added to its durability and appeal. However, the removal of the headphone jack was a controversial move, paving the way for wireless audio and a new era of mobile accessories.

Samsung Galaxy S7: The Android Flagship
Samsung’s Galaxy S7 was the epitome of Android excellence in 2016, with a 5.1-inch Quad HD display, a quad-core Qualcomm Snapdragon 820 processor, and up to 4GB of RAM. The device also featured a 12-megapixel rear camera with optical image stabilization, as well as a 3000mAh battery that provided all-day battery life. The Galaxy S7’s design was equally impressive, with a premium metal and glass construction that exuded luxury and sophistication.
Features and Innovations
The Galaxy S7 introduced several innovative features, including IP68 water and dust resistance, wireless charging, and a microSD card slot for expandable storage. The device also came with Samsung Pay, a mobile payments platform that allowed users to make contactless transactions. These features, combined with its impressive hardware, made the Galaxy S7 a formidable competitor to the iPhone 7 and other high-end smartphones.
Software and User Experience
The Galaxy S7 ran on Android 6.0 Marshmallow out of the box, with Samsung’s proprietary TouchWiz interface providing a unique and feature-rich user experience. While some critics argued that TouchWiz was bloated and cumbersome, many users appreciated its customization options and exclusive features, such as Multi-Window mode and Quick Connect.
Google Pixel: The Pure Android Experience
Google’s Pixel was a game-changer in 2016, offering a pure Android experience that was free from bloatware and manufacturer customization. With a 5-inch Full HD display, a quad-core Qualcomm Snapdragon 821 processor, and up to 4GB of RAM, the Pixel was a powerful and efficient device. The phone’s 12.3-megapixel rear camera was also widely praised, with its exceptional low-light performance and laser autofocus.
Software and Integration
The Pixel ran on Android 7.1 Nougat out of the box, with Google Assistant providing a personalized and intuitive user experience. The device also came with unlimited cloud storage for photos and videos, making it an attractive option for Google enthusiasts and those invested in the company’s ecosystem. The Pixel’s seamless integration with other Google services, such as Gmail and Google Drive, further enhanced its appeal.

What were some of the most significant innovations in phone technology in 2016?
In 2016, several significant innovations emerged in phone technology, including the introduction of dual-camera systems, such as the Apple iPhone 7 Plus and Huawei P9, which offered enhanced zoom capabilities, depth sensing, and image quality. Another notable innovation was the use of modular designs, such as the LG G5 and Motorola Moto Z, which enabled users to customize and upgrade their devices with interchangeable modules and accessories.
